Chinese Social Media app TikTok has been blocked by Pakistan’s Telecommunications Authority (PTA) on Friday for failing to filter out the immoral and indecent content. The app has remained quite popular amongst the younger generation and as per an analytics firm, it had been installed over 43 million times in Pakistan. That makes Pakistan the 12th largest market for the company.
The ban is the result of the company’s compliance with the Pakistani government’s concerns. PTA has confirmed that they will review their decision subjected to a satisfactory mechanism by TikTok. Recently, the app was blocked in India; its largest market and is facing a threat of being banned in the United States and reconsideration in countries like Australia.
Five dating apps, including Tinder and Grinder, were also blocked by the PTA in the last month. Over these bans, Pakistani digital rights activists believe that these decisions undermine the government’s dream of a Digital Pakistan.
